| | Research Interests | Metal Extraction and Molten Salts
- Aluminium electrowinning, cryolite and alternative electrolytes.
- Aluminium plating from room temperature electrolytes.
- Electrochemical studies in molten glass.
- Vanadium extraction from fly-ash and spent catalysts.
Battery Research
- Vanadium Redox-cell batteries for remote area and load levelling applications.
- Commercial prototype design and development.
- Field testing of vanadium battery in Solar House applications and electric golf cart.
- Lead acid batteries, electrode reactions and effect of additives.
- Novel electrode materials for Lithium Ion Batteries.
- Fuel cells and Biofuel Cells.
- Vanadium Halide Redox Fuel Cells
- Batteries for electric vehicles.
Electrode Processes and Electrode Materials
- Chronopotentiometry, cyclic voltammetry and rotating ring-disc voltammetry for study of mechanisms of electrode reactions at different electrode surfaces.
- Preparation and characterization of conductive polymers and conductive plastic composites.
- Electrode activation and modification.
Membranes for Electrochemical Systems
- Membrane characterization for redox cell and fuel cell applications. Membrane modification.
